Consumer reviews have become an integral part of our decision-making process when it comes to making purchases Before buying a product or seeking a service, most of us turn to online platforms to check what others have to say about it However, there is a common problem that often arises – limited reviews Limited reviews can frustrate and confuse consumers, but fortunately, there are effective ways to resolve this issue and make more informed choices.
Limited reviews occur when there is an insufficient number of reviews available for a particular product or service This may happen for various reasons For niche products, there simply may not be a large enough consumer base to generate a significant number of reviews In other cases, companies may deliberately limit the number of reviews shown to maintain a positive image Whatever the reason may be, limited reviews leave consumers with inadequate information to base their decisions on.
One way to resolve limited reviews is by expanding the scope of available reviews Rather than relying solely on one platform, consumers can explore different websites and forums to gather a wider range of opinions While popular review platforms like Amazon or Yelp might have limited reviews for smaller niche products, industry-specific forums or social media groups might provide more insights By accessing multiple sources, consumers can gather a more comprehensive understanding of the product or service under consideration.
In addition to widening the scope of available reviews, consumers can also reach out to experts in the field Consulting with professionals who have in-depth knowledge and experience can help fill in the gaps left by limited customer reviews For instance, if you are considering buying a specialized camera lens and cannot find enough reviews online, you could seek advice from a professional photographer or join photography forums to gather insight from those who have used similar products Resolving Limited reviews. By tapping into the expertise of specialists, consumers can gain valuable information that will aid them in making a more informed decision.
Another effective method to resolve limited reviews is to ask the companies directly for more information If you have doubts or concerns about a product or service due to the limited reviews available, it is worth contacting the company directly to inquire further Reputable companies will be responsive to customer queries and provide additional details, such as technical specifications or product comparisons, offering consumers a better understanding of what they are considering purchasing.
When faced with limited reviews, it is essential for consumers to critically analyze the available information Instead of solely relying on the quantity of reviews, it is crucial to assess the quality and reliability of the existing ones Look for detailed and informative reviews that provide specific details about the product or service While a small number of reviews may be all you have, prioritizing those that are comprehensive and unbiased can significantly aid decision-making.
Finally, consumers can contribute to resolving the issue of limited reviews by leaving their own feedback By leaving honest and detailed reviews about products or services they have used, individuals can help future consumers make more informed choices Actively participating in the review process can contribute to building a more comprehensive and accurate representation of the quality and reliability of various products and services.
In conclusion, limited reviews can hinder decision-making, but there are effective ways to resolve this issue Expanding the scope of available reviews, consulting experts, reaching out to companies for additional information, critically analyzing existing reviews, and leaving feedback are all useful methods to overcome the limitations of limited reviews By employing these strategies, consumers can make more informed choices and contribute to a more transparent and reliable marketplace So, the next time you encounter limited reviews, take action and make your purchase decisions with confidence.
